Police have seized hundreds of cannabis plants after raiding a house in a Sheffield village.

Officers went into a house in Ecclesfield on Friday after getting a warrant to search the property from magistrates, and found over 150 plants in the property, being grown with lights and heating in place. They have today published pictures of the plants found.

South Yorkshire Police’s Ecclesfield, Chapeltown, High Green and Grenoside neighbourhood policing team said the raids came as they were continuing to crack down on drugs issues in the Ecclesfield area. They said in a statement: “On Friday, officers executed a drugs warrant in Ecclesfield and seized over 150 cannabis plants and arrested a man in connection with production of cannabis.
